Death Riders of Hel (Bloodsong #2)
Asa Drake
Rated: 3.67 of 5 stars
3.67
· 3 ratings · 249 pages · Published: 01 Mar 1986
Now, the warrior woman Bloodsong must face these ghoulish emissaries of Evil in a battle to the death, for the forces of Hel have kidnapped her daughter, and are determined to awaken the dark magic buried in her soul. From the mystical island of the Berserkers to wise Freya's domain, Bloodsong and her companions must prepare for the ultimate battle, honing their swords to lethal rediness, waiting for the onslaught to come.
